USO DEL MANEJADOR DE BASES DE DATOS MYSQL
PRESENTACIÓN
MySQL Database Server es el manejador de base de datos de código fuente abierto más usado del mundo. Fue desarrollado inicialmente para manejar grandes bases de datos mucho más que las soluciones existentes, y ha sido usado exitosamente por muchos años en ambientes de producción de alta demanda. A través de un constante desarrollo, MySQL Server ofrece hoy una rica variedad de funciones; su conectividad, velocidad y seguridad lo hacen altamente satisfactorio para accesar bases de datos en Internet, Código abierto significa que es posible para cualquier persona usarlo y modificarlo al igual que se puede bajar el código fuente de MySQL y usarlo sin pagar o estudiarlo y ajustarlo a sus necesidades.
MySQL usa el GPL (GNU General Public License) para definir qué puede hacer y qué no puede hacer con el software en diferentes situaciones.
OBJETIVOS
OBJETIVO
El participante:
- Aplicará los elementos básicos de MySQL para la creación y explotación de bases de datos; asimismo, implementará mecanismos de seguridad para realizar la administración y mantenimiento.
PERFIL DE INGRESO
El curso está dirigido a personas que deseen implementar bases de datos relacionales robustas tanto en una plataforma Windows como Linux.
Los interesados deberán:
- Haber acreditado o demostrar conocimientos equivalentes al curso de Introducción al diseño de base de datos.
- Contar con una cuenta de correo activa y acceso a Internet para conectarse al sitio del curso.
- Disponer de al menos 10 horas a la semana para revisar a fondo los contenidos y realizar las actividades de cada tema.
TEMARIO
1. Introducción
1.1. ¿Qué es MySQL?
1.2. Configuración del ambiente de desarrollo
1.3. Uso de mysqladmin
1.4. Uso del cliente mysql
2. Introducción a MySQL
2.1. Tipos de datos
2.2. Tipos de tablas
2.3. Operadores
2.4. Funciones
2.5. Comentarios
2.6. Constraint
2.7. Opciones de MySQL
2.8. Elementos básicos de SQL
3. Estructuras
3.1. Bases de datos
3.2. Tablas
4. Manejo de la información
4.1. Selección, ordenamiento y agrupación de la información
4.2. Insertar, actualizar y eliminar información
4.3. Funciones
5. Seguridad y administración
5.1. Usuarios
5.2. Privilegios
5.3. Acceso a los datos
5.4. Archivos MySQL
5.5. Mantenimiento de la base de datos
5.6. Copias de seguridad
DURACIÓN
El curso tiene una duración de 5 semanas, equivalente a 30 horas.
FORMA DE TRABAJO
- Al inicio de cada bloque estarán disponibles los recursos y actividades para los temas, que deberá realizar al final de cada bloque, en las fechas señaladas en cada una de ellas.
- El curso consta de 4 temas los cuales deberán ser revisados en un lapso máximo de cinco semanas. El usuario es responsable de distribuir su tiempo para estudiar los temas que le corresponden en el periodo indicado.
- Para todas las actividades que se indiquen a lo largo del desarrollo del curso, el participante contará con la asistencia de un asesor ya sea por medio del foro o a través del servicio de mensajes de la plataforma.
- Al finalizar el estudio del tema correspondiente, las prácticas o ejercicios que se pidan en cada unidad se subirán a la plataforma, en los espacios destinados para tal fin.
- Para comunicarse con sus compañeros o con el asesor, deberá utilizar el foro o a trav&ecaute;s del servicio de mensajes de la plataforma
- En cada tema se abrirá un foro de discusión relacionado con el mismo, en el cual deberá participar según se solicite.
EVALUACIÓN
- La calificación mínima aprobatoria es de 8.0.
- El lapso máximo para aprobar todos los temas es de 5 semanas contada a partir del inicio del curso.
- La evaluación se compone de los siguientes puntos:
Prácticas
|
75% |
Participación en los foros
|
25% |
Total |
100% |
REQUERIMIENTOS MÍNIMOS
Deberá tener disponible un equipo de cómputo con las siguientes características:
HARDWARE:
- Procesador Core i3 o superior.
- Memoria RAM instalada de 1GB o superior.
- Espacio en el disco duro de al menos 1GB para la instalación de los programas y archivos de trabajo.
- Monitor Monitor SVGA.
- Bocinas o audífonos para algunos recursos multimedia.
SOFTWARE:
- Un navegador web (Microsoft Explorer, Mozilla Firefox, Opera etc.), es recomendable utilizar las versiones más actuales.
- Adobe Reader 9 u otro software libre para leer los documentos del curso.
- MySQL 8.0.21.0, puede descargarlo del sitio de MySQL.com.